Keep on Trekking

Paramont throws a bone to sci-fi fans

Even more hush-hush than news of a Romulan cloaking device are the details of Star Trek: Voyager, Paramount's third Star Trek TV spin-off. Next Generation execs Rick Berman, Michael Piller, and Jeri Taylor have been secretly hashing out concepts for the new series-which will be the cornerstone of Paramount's planned fifth network, due in January 1995. Speculation ranges from its being a show created for Deep Space Nine's morphing Odo (Rene Auberjonois) to its , revolving around a female starship commander. But all Paramount will let slip is that Voyager will be set on another star-ship in the 24th century, at about the same time as Next Generation. Not even a Vulcan mind probe will get the company to reveal more.

The silent treatment isn't bothering TV stations currently airing Next Generation, which is scheduled to warp off the air and into a movie next year. Says Walter DeHaven, general manager of Paramount-owned KTXA in Dallas-Fort Worth,"The franchise of Star Trek has such a track record that even sight unseen it's worth its weight in gold."
